Far East

Far East

Because of BCC's expanding global presence and growing business BCC central office had regional offices in various locations headed by a senior executive designated as Regional General Manager.

Regional offices covered a single geographical area that made it easier for BCC to extend regional support to its local branches and offices. In addition, the regional offices undertook a range of functions benefitting BCC group worldwide.

BCC regional office would oversee, plan, coordinate and provide regional support for activities to BCC branches and offices within its defined region. BCC regional offices were involved in administrative and financial matters and were responsible for coordination, planning, budgeting, business review, credit approvals, staff recruitment and training, endorsement of business initiatives, assistance in strengthening BCC's strategic relations in the region, and maintaining close liaison with country managers and senior management at BCC central office.

The BCC Far East Regional Office was in Hong Kong at:

802 Admiralty Centre, Tower 1,
18 Harcourt Road,
Hong Kong,

Telephone: 5-297031/6
Telex: 72042 BCCRO HX
Fax: 852527 5518
